Mündəricat:

Cypherbot (robot köməkçisi): 9 addım
Cypherbot (robot köməkçisi): 9 addım

Video: Cypherbot (robot köməkçisi): 9 addım

Video: Cypherbot (robot köməkçisi): 9 addım
Video: Cypherbot - Remote Control via XBee 2024, Noyabr
Anonim
Cypherbot (robot köməkçisi)
Cypherbot (robot köməkçisi)
Cypherbot (robot köməkçisi)
Cypherbot (robot köməkçisi)

Cyphersoft, dostunuz ola biləcək və işləyərkən sizə kömək edə biləcək köməkçi bir robotdur. Danışa və gəzə bilər. Təsəvvür edə biləcəyiniz hər şey üçün fərdiləşdirə və istifadə edə bilərsiniz. İndi yalnız Arduino və Raspberry Pi ilə ağıllı bir robot edə bilərsiniz. Bu robotu təkmilləşdirmək üçün hər hansı bir təklifiniz varsa şərhlərdə təklif edin.

Təchizat

1. Raspberry Pi (sıfırdan başqa hər hansı bir model işləyəcək)

2. L293D IC və ya L293D Motor sürücü qalxanı

3. USB mikrofonu

4. Raspberry Pi TFT Ekranı (3,5 düym)

5. MDF lövhəsi və ya karton

6. Servo mühərrikləri (x6)

7. B. O. Motorlar (x 6 və ya 4)

8. Yapışqan Tabancası

9. Arduino (istənilən model işləyəcək)

10. USB veb kamerası

Addım 1: Dizayn

Dizayn
Dizayn
Dizayn
Dizayn

İstənilən şassi işləyəcək

Üz dizayn şablonu yuxarıda verilmişdir

Addım 2: Kod

Kod
Kod
Kod
Kod
Kod
Kod

Aşağıdakı əmri istifadə edərək kodu yükləyin

git klonu

cypherbot qovluğunu açın və qovluğun məzmununu ana qovluğa kopyalayın

Addım 3: Asılılıqların quraşdırılması

Asılılıqların quraşdırılması
Asılılıqların quraşdırılması
Asılılıqların quraşdırılması
Asılılıqların quraşdırılması

Aşağıdakı əmrləri daxil edin:

1. chmod +x install.sh

2../ install.sh

Addım 4: Səs parametrlərini konfiqurasiya edin

Səs Ayarlarının Konfiqurasiyası
Səs Ayarlarının Konfiqurasiyası
Səs Ayarlarının Konfiqurasiyası
Səs Ayarlarının Konfiqurasiyası
Səs Ayarlarının Konfiqurasiyası
Səs Ayarlarının Konfiqurasiyası

Aşağıdakı addımları izləyin-

1. Aşağıdakı əmri daxil edin- sudo nano /usr/share/alsa/alsa.conf

2. Satırları tapana qədər aşağı diyirləyin

defaults.ctl.card 0

defaults.pcm.card 0

3. Onları dəyişdirin

default.ctl.card 1

defaults.pcm.card 1

4. Ctrl+x düymələrini basın və konfiqurasiyanı saxlamaq üçün y düyməsini basın

Addım 5: Dövrə

Dövrə
Dövrə

Robot üçün dövrə diaqramı

Addım 6: Motorun montajı

Motor yığımı
Motor yığımı
Motor yığımı
Motor yığımı
Motor yığımı
Motor yığımı

Addım 7: Robotun yığılması

Robotun yığılması
Robotun yığılması
Robotun yığılması
Robotun yığılması
Robotun yığılması
Robotun yığılması

Addım 8: Cypherbot Qovluğundan Ino Faylını Arduino -ya yükləyin

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in
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in
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in
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in
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in
Ino Faylını Cypherbot Qovluğundan Arduino -ya yükləyin

Addım 9: Robotun işləməsi üçün Python Scriptini işə salın

Python3 cypherbot.py əmrini işlədin

Robot qaçmağa başlayacaq

Tövsiyə: